Job description

Position Summary

This is a salaried position scheduled at 50 hours/week; however, during training, this position is paid at an equivalent hourly rate and scheduled 40 hours per week.

What you'll do
  • Lead and develop teams by teaching, training, and providing feedback; communicate effectively across all levels; introduce and lead change initiatives; set clear expectations; and align team efforts with business objectives.
  • Model and uphold exceptional customer service standards; manage customer service initiatives; resolve customer issues; and lead process improvements to ensure a high-quality customer experience.
  • Drive store financial performance by reviewing P&L statements; assist in budgeting and expense control; ensure effective merchandise presentation; and develop strategies to mitigate shrink and achieve sales and profit goals.
  • Hire, train, mentor, and develop hourly associates; set expectations; recognize contributions; and ensure a diverse and inclusive work environment.
  • Coordinate activities with stakeholders; support business and customer needs; build accountability; and foster continuous improvement and learning.
  • Ensure compliance with company policies and uphold ethical standards; support Walmart’s mission and values; and promote a culture of integrity and ethics.

Minimum Qualifications

Two years of college; or one year of retail and supervisory experience; or two years of general work experience with supervisory experience. Additional requirements include completing all job-specific training and assessments.

Preferred Qualifications

Bachelor of Science in Business Management and Leadership or related field; experience supervising five or more direct reports including performance management, mentoring, hiring, and firing.
